How does Venice Token (VVV) work?

The Venice protocol operates on a hybrid architecture that combines two key components:

  •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M) Compatibility: This allows the protocol to support standard smart contracts and ensure seamless interoperability with the vast Ethereum and Mantle ecosystems. Developers can build and deploy familiar dApps.
  • Morpheus Privacy Engine: This is the core privacy layer. It utilizes advanced cryptographic techniques, likely including zero-knowledge proofs (zk-SNARKs/zk-STARKs) or secure multi-party computation, to obfuscate transaction details. This means sender, receiver, and amount data can be kept private while still being verified as valid on-chain.

Transactions and smart contract interactions are batched and settled on the Mantle L2, which posts compressed proof data back to Ethereum L1 for finality. This structure provides the privacy benefits of the Morpheus engine with the low fees and high throughput of Mantle.


What makes Venice Token (VVV) unique and valuable?

VVV's value proposition centers on bringing practical, scalable privacy to a high-performance Ethereum L2.

  • Privacy on a Scalable L2: While privacy protocols exist, many operate on Ethereum mainnet with high fees or on isolated chains. Venice is built directly on Mantle, offering private transactions at significantly lower cost and higher speed.
  • EVM + Privacy Hybrid: The integration of the Morpheus engine with full EVM compatibility is a key technical differentiator. It allows for private states within otherwise public and composable smart contracts, opening new design possibilities for DeFi, gaming, and social dApps.
  • Governance Utility: VVV token holders have the right to propose and vote on protocol upgrades, parameter adjustments (like fee structures), treasury management, and the integration of new features within the Morpheus engine. This gives the community direct control over the privacy infrastructure.
  • Growing Privacy Demand: As blockchain adoption grows, the need for transactional privacy for both individuals and enterprises becomes more critical, positioning protocols like Venice as essential middleware.

What is Venice Token (VVV) used for?

The VVV token has several core utilities within its ecosystem:

  • Governance: The primary use is for decentralized governance. Holding VVV grants voting power on all major protocol decisions via the Venice DAO.
  • Protocol Fees: Transactions or specific operations using the Venice privacy features may require fees paid in VVV, creating inherent demand for the token.
  • Staking & Security: Token holders may be able to stake VVV to participate in network security or validation tasks for the privacy layer, earning rewards in return.
  • Access & Incentives: VVV can be used to access premium privacy features or distributed as rewards to liquidity providers, developers, and early users to bootstrap network activity.

How to keep your VVV Coin safe?

Securing your VVV tokens is crucial. Follow these best practices:

  • Use a Secure Wallet: Store your VVV in a reputable, non-custodial wallet where you control the private keys. Hardware wallets (like Ledger or Trezor) that support EVM-based tokens (ERC-20) via Mantle network are the most secure option.
  • Beware of Scams: Never share your private keys, seed phrase, or passwords with anyone. Be cautious of unsolicited messages, fake support accounts, and phishing websites impersonating the Venice or Mantle platforms.
  • Verify Transactions: Always double-check contract addresses and network details (Mantle) before sending or receiving VVV.
  • Keep Software Updated: Ensure your wallet software and any connected devices have the latest security updates.
